When you get a quote for exterior painting, the final number depends on a few straightforward things. The biggest factors are the total square footage of your home and how many stories high it is. If your siding has rotting wood, major cracks, or old lead paint that needs scraping, that adds labor time. Using premium, long-lasting coatings also shifts the budget compared to standard options. Acrylic paint is a fast-drying, water-soluble medium commonly used for arts and crafts. It is excellent for canvas or small decorative projects, but it is not suitable for large-scale exterior house painting, which requires industrial-grade latex or elastomeric coatings for weather resistance. Summer offers the best conditions for paint to bond quickly, provided it isn't scorching hot. Direct, intense sunlight can cause paint to dry too fast, which leads to brush marks or uneven texture. Our teams often adjust their hours to paint during the cooler parts of the morning. This keeps the finish smooth and durable despite the heat of the season.
Spray painting can be fast, but it's not always the best for every surface in Clovis. The pros will look at your home's condition. They decide if spraying is the right method. Sometimes, rolling and brushing give a thicker, more durable coat. This is especially true for older homes or those with rough textures. They'll explain the pros and cons for your specific house. This ensures you get the best finish and protection.

Sherwin-Williams offers many colors, and getting samples is a smart move for your Clovis home. The pros can guide you on how to test them. Look at the colors at different times of day. See how they appear in direct sun and shade. This helps you choose the perfect shade that will look great year-round. They can advise on the best finishes too, like satin or semi-gloss.

Before painting your Clovis home, thorough preparation is key. The pros will clean the exterior to remove dirt and mildew. They'll scrape away any loose or peeling paint. Any cracks or holes in the siding will be filled and repaired. They'll also protect windows, doors, and landscaping with drop cloths and tape. This ensures a smooth, lasting finish.
